This is a call for feature requests for the next release of The Scripter's
Scrapbook. Please reply direct to [EMAIL PROTECTED] for coordination,
unless you feel your request has discussion merit!

A selection of requests already received:
- Transfer of current settings and entries to updates
- List selection by entries with attachments
- Multiple page print preview
- Global text wrap option
- Identify new samples in updates
- Copy to clipboard (now in 4.01)
- Search Internet and archives (now in 4.01)
- Import/convert files as entry records (now in 4.01)
